While Test Generator can print tests and test keys, the application’s main focus is built around giving tests on a computer (Windows or Intranet/Internet. One of the principle advantages is the streamlining of test delivery, grading, reports and test administration.
Printing a test and test key for traditional "paper and pencil" tests.
Printing a test to share with other test authors/administrative-level users.
Printing test/test key reference copies for filing.
Printing/sharing tests with teacher/trainer colleagues who do not have a TG solution.
You can print a test, test key, or a randomized test and its corresponding randomized test key, using the Simple Test Key Report. To print a randomized copy of a test, the test’s randomization feature must be activated.
Print a test and answer (bubble) sheet to use with Test Generator’s TG Scan utility. TG Scan enables test authors to print paper tests and an answer (bubble) sheet. Once a test is completed, the answer sheets are scanned into TG’s database using the TG Scan utility. Contact us for more details.
In addition to the print options described above, you can preview and print a test or test key by selecting either report. Once selected, a separate Class column appears to the right of the tree view. From the Classes column select a test and either double-click the test icon or select the Print Preview icon in the icon toolbar. Either action displays the print preview window.
The Test Key and Simple Test Key Reports include additional print options.
In TG, an open test is in the test edit mode. The Print Setup, Preview and Print commands are accessible under the File menu and the Print and Print Preview icons are active under the icon toolbar. These commands behave the same way as those described above (see Print Options under TG's Main Menu).
